What the Constitution Means to Me
By Heidi Schreck
Directed by Lenore Howard
Celebrate our nation’s 250th Anniversary with this endearingly humorous and deeply affecting
autobiographical story of playwright Heidi Schreck. Fifteen-year-old Heidi earned her college tuition by winning American Legion U. S. Constitutional debate contests across the nation. Reflecting on those years, middle-age Heidi examines the personal and the political, connecting the experiences of women from her own family history and making abstract law deeply human. In the end, the play challenges us to reconsider the relevance of our U.S. Constitution.
